The Fault List screen displays any outstanding fault codes and
shows a mimic of the printer; the area containing the masked fault is
highlighted in light yellow. For greatest printer productivity, clear any
masked faults at your earliest opportunity.
When the printer stops because of a fault, display the Fault List
screen after clearing the fault to see if there are any masked faults.
Clear these masked faults before continuing with the print job.
When there is a fault that cannot be masked and therefore causes
the printer to stop, the Fault icon (a dark yellow triangle with an
exclamation point inside) appears on the printer console and the
Attention light flashes. The Fault screen appears on the printer
console, highlighting (in dark yellow) the area(s) of the printer
containing the fault and giving instructions for clearing the fault.
If a fault exists in the system at the time that a masked fault occurs,
the printer console displays only the Fault icon. The remaining
masked fault condition messages still display in the message area of
the printer console.
